Sunitinib in combination with gemcitabine for advanced solid tumours: a phase I dose-finding study

Summary
Sunitinib combined with gemcitabine showed promising antitumor activity in advanced solid tumors. The combination was well-tolerated and safely administered at maximum doses, with no significant drug interactions observed.
Area of Science:
- Oncology
- Clinical Pharmacology
- Drug Development
Background:
- Phase I dose-finding study of sunitinib plus gemcitabine in advanced solid tumors.
- Investigated safety, pharmacokinetics, and maximum tolerated dose (MTD).
Purpose of the Study:
- Determine the MTD, safety, and pharmacokinetics of sunitinib plus gemcitabine.
- Evaluate two different dosing schedules for the combination therapy.
Main Methods:
- Two schedules evaluated: sunitinib (25-50 mg/day) with gemcitabine (750-1250 mg/m²).
- Schedule 4/2: sunitinib 4 weeks on/2 weeks off; gemcitabine days 1, 8, 22, 29.
- Schedule 2/1: sunitinib 2 weeks on/1 week off; gemcitabine days 1, 8.
Main Results:
- 44 patients treated (Schedule 4/2, n=8; Schedule 2/1, n=36).
- MTD not reached on Schedule 2/1 due to absence of dose-limiting toxicities.
- Observed antitumor activity, including responses in renal cell carcinoma patients.
Conclusions:
- Sunitinib plus gemcitabine on Schedule 2/1 was well-tolerated and safely administered at maximum doses.
- No clinically significant drug-drug interactions were identified.
- Combination therapy demonstrated antitumor activity in advanced solid tumors.
